Hi, Just got this email from eBay, instruction of opt out marketing calls from eBay, share with all who needs this.

You were recently contacted by eBay. At your request, I'd like to follow up with instructions to opt-out of telephone communication from eBay in the future. This email will provide you instructions to change your communication preferences on eBay. Please note, eBay will not make these preference changes on your behalf.

To change your communication preferences, please sign in to "My eBay" by clicking on the "My eBay" link found at the top of the eBay home page, click the "Account" tab, and choose "Notification Preferences" and then remove the check mark next to "Phone updates and promotions" in the "Promotions and Surveys" section.

Changing your Phone updates and promotions preference will remove you from any future phone communications not related to your account activity on eBay, including events or promotions offered to eBay members. You can review and update your preferences at any time.
